The Association of Farmworker Opportunity Programs (AFOP) is a civil society organization grounded in Washington, D.C., operating within the civic and social sector. It coordinates and supports a network of 52 member groups across 49 states and Puerto Rico to serve migrant and seasonal farmworkers, providing job training, pesticide safety education, emergency assistance, and advocacy on behalf of farmworkers who grow and harvest the nation’s food. All member programs participate in the National Farmworker Jobs Program, a U.S. Department of Labor grant initiative aimed at educating and equipping farmworkers with skills that lead to sustainable employment with benefits. In addition to NFJP activities, AFOP’s members run diverse initiatives such as Head Start, migrant education, and housing counseling, while national staff pursue health and safety programming and campaigns focused on children in the fields. The organization is based in Washington, D.C., and operates with a national reach through its multi-state network to address the needs and rights of farmworkers and their families.
